About

Mahatma Gandhi Marine National Park at Wandoor spreads over an area of 281 sq. km. and includes as many as 15 uninhabited islands surrounded by the sea. With an objective to preserve the tropical ecosystem this marine national park was set up in the year 1983. The park is located at a distance of 29 km. from Port Blair. From the 15 islands, only the islands of Jolly Buoy and Red Skin are open to visitors, alternatively for six months each. The islands are all located close to each other and the terrain is mostly rocky and dotted with lush green mangrove forests.Beaches open for tourists are shallow and safe for swimming, scuba diving and snorkelling.Boat journey to the park from Port Blair costs Rs. 450/- which includes 2.5 hours’ time allowed at islands of Jolly Buoy (December to May) and Red Skin (May to November). It is advisable to have carry some packed food along. A ferry ride is the best option to explore the mangrove forests and the charm of post card pretty village of Wandoorupclose. The glass bottomed boat tours attracts tourists and are a delightful option to explore the diverse and rich aquatic life. How to Reach

By air: The nearest airport is Vir Savarkar Airport, Port Blair which is 19km. away from Mahatma Gandhi Marine National Park (Wandoor).

By rail: There are no rail heads close to Mahatma Gandhi Marine National Park. The Paradeep Railway Station is 1169 km. from the Mahatma Gandhi Marine National Park is the nearest available rail head. Tourists generally reach Port Blair by air.

By road: This national park is at a distance of 29 km. from Port Blair and is located along the South Western coast of South Andaman. It can be reached by taxis or bus. You can take tourist coaches plying to Wandoor from Andaman Tea House or regular bus from the bus terminus.
